What I dont understand is why get ball joint spacers for something that an alignment can take care of?? If the wheel has camber problems then elongate the holes in the strut and adjust it... Thats what they are there for... Unless I am missing something major?

 

These aren't to correct static camber. As you said, that can be taken of with an alignment. This is to change the angle of the control arm to give us a better camber curve because we screw the camber curve up when we lower the car.
